Interface Pressure Mapping Ipm Clinical Use Of вђ Interfaceођ The need for a set of guidelines for the clinical use of interface pressure mapping (ipm) arose from the work of the iso ch173 sc1 wg11 working group on standards for wheelchair seating. the working group had a project being conducted by one of the task groups to establish means of assessing the physical. Follow up ranged from 48 hours to 12 months. studies assessed interface pressure using single cell pressure transducers or pressure mapping mats. development and healing of pressure ulcers was evaluated by manual or visual inspection of skin or from photographs. a variety of methods were used to stage pressure ulcers.

Tactilus Human Body Interface Pressure Mapping System Cad Engineering A systematic review was performed to address the research question of whether interface pressure can be used to predict the development of pressure ulcers or to determine the prognosis of an ulcer once developed. seven studies were identified that measured interface pressure and used the development or healing of pressure ulcers as an outcome. Interface pressure mapping (ipm) has long been a useful assessment tool to augment the seating evaluation. technological improvements in both hardware and software have made steady advances across manufacturers. likewise, progress has been made in the scientific study of the clinical application of pressure mapping. this course will. 1. share information about clinical use of interface pressure mapping from the literature. 2. discuss the benefits and limits we experience clinically with ipm. 3. what else needs to be done in this area to help clinicians use ipm with confidence? interface pressure mapping by laura titus ot reg. Conclusions and relevance: in this randomized clinical trial to evaluate the efficacy of cbpm technology in the reduction of interface pressure and the incidence of pis in a tertiary acute care center, no statistically significant benefit was seen for any of the primary outcomes. these results suggest that longer duration of monitoring and.
